In a notable development for the cryptocurrency market, Bybit, one of the leading exchanges, has revealed plans to delist three trading pairs. According to the assessment of specialists presented in the publication, this decision underscores the ongoing changes and regulatory pressures within the digital asset space.
Delisting Announcement
The affected trading pairs include
- ELX
- ODOS
- DMAIL
Action Required for Traders
Traders are urged to take action promptly, as they will have a one-week grace period post-delisting to withdraw their tokens from Bybit wallets. This proactive approach is essential for users to avoid any potential losses or complications related to their holdings.
